  1. To bear, bring or carry down. transitive
    — Immediately from the downborne elements sprung forth The Word of The God to the pure creation of all Nature, …
  2. To bear or press down (on); press upon; depress; subdue. transitive
    — Further, Caulis Bambusae downbears the stomach, thus downbearing upwardly counterflowing depressive heat.
  3. To lessen; reduce. transitive
    — The stomach channel's uniting point, Zu San Li, is chosen in order to drain the stomach and downbear counterflow.

词源

From Middle English dounberen, equivalent to down- + bear.
